On-board planning for New Millennium Deep Space One autonomy

Abstract
The Deep Space One (DS1)mission, scheduled to fly in 1998, will be thefirst NASA spacecraft to feature an on-boardplanner. The planner is part of an artificialintelligence based control architecture thatcomprises the planner/scheduler, a planexecution engine, and a model-based faultdiagnosis and reconfiguration engine. Thisautonomy architecture reduces mission costsand increases mission quality by enabling highlevelcommanding, robust fault responses, andopportunistic responses to...
